Do people still collect salt and pepper shakers? Salt and pepper shakers are a classic collectible item. Though their popularity has waned in recent years, there are still many people who collect salt and pepper shakers. There are a variety of reasons why people collect salt and pepper shakers. Some people collect them for their aesthetic value, while others collect them for their historical value. Whatever the reason, salt and pepper shakers make for a fun and interesting collection.

Norpro 742 Glass Salt or Pepper Shaker, Clear Review:


This item replaced a tall salt shaker made of acrylic that required filling from the bottom while keeping your finger away from the holes, was challenging to clean, and eventually began to look cloudy. These three issues are solved by this shaker. We bought the Oxo Good Grips Pepper Mill, however it doesn't look like they have a salt shaker to go with it. It has no frills, is simple to clean, flows smoothly, is made of glass and metal, and fills from the top, which is just what we were looking for in a basic shaker. This receives a 5-star rating for being about $4, however if you don't like the basic diner style, you might not agree.
